A Graduate Certificate in Spatial Analysis for Urban Planning equips students with advanced skills in Geographic Information Systems (GIS) and spatial data analysis techniques crucial for addressing complex urban challenges. The program focuses on practical application, allowing students to analyze geospatial data and interpret results effectively.
Learning outcomes typically include mastering spatial data management, proficiency in using GIS software (like ArcGIS or QGIS), and developing expertise in various spatial analysis methods such as spatial statistics, network analysis, and spatial modeling. Graduates are prepared to conduct sophisticated spatial analyses relevant to urban planning projects.
The duration of a Graduate Certificate in Spatial Analysis for Urban Planning usually ranges from one to two semesters, depending on the institution and the course load. This intensive program is designed to be completed within a shorter timeframe compared to a full master's degree, making it ideal for professionals seeking to upskill or transition into a new career.
